Jon Bon Jovi's Triumphant Return: A Night to Remember!

In a powerful display of resilience and passion, Jon Bon Jovi graced the stage of England's national stadium for the first of three sold-out shows, marking a significant chapter in his illustrious career. The concert celebrated not only the music but also Bon Jovi's remarkable recovery from vocal cord surgery in 2022, bringing joy to a crowd of 90,000 loyal fans.

A Journey of Redemption

Five years after a less than stellar performance at the same venue, Jon Bon Jovi returned with a renewed spirit. The night began with a heartfelt cover of The Beatles' "With a Little Help From My Friends," paying tribute to the devoted fans who stood by him during his recovery journey. The emotional depth of this performance set the tone for an unforgettable evening.
